Last week I had a crappy few days! I was caught up in self doubt from some bad decisions I had made, and felt about the same way I feel when I crash on my mountain bike: stinging, scabbed, bloody, and sore.
Self doubt breeds self doubt.
I was caught in this for a few days last week, and it was effecting all of my relationships and my ability to be the leader that I knew I needed to be. While in a plane this past weekend, I was reading in the Bible. It was in Luke chapter 4, verse 8: “And Jesus answered and said unto him, GET BEHIND ME SATAN.”
GET BEHIND ME.
The words were powerful and while I don’t claim to be a Bible scholar in any way, I instantly related them to me.
“What do I need to ‘Get Behind Me’?” I asked myself. I proceeded to make a long list. The reality is that we all have a crappy few days. We are then faced with a moment of decision.
We either fall into being a victim, or we forge forward as a leader and live the life we know we are called to lead.
Here are some of the things I believe we all need to “GET BEHIND US”:
-Our mistakes
-Our weak, incorrect perceptions of life
-Our incorrect judgements about who we are
-Our poor health
-Judgements about other people
-Our addictions
-Lies we tell ourselves
-Bad friends who don’t bring out the very best in us
-Lack of forgiveness
-Our small thinking
-Our poor confidence
-Our mismanagement of money
-Our laziness
-Our anger
-Our doubt
-Our cynicism towards life
-Our overly busy lifestyles
-Endless hours of TV viewing that numbs our brain
-Our selfishness
This is just a short list. Many of these I personally have put behind me or need to constantly be aware that I must put them behind me.
Since true change is found in ACTION, I encourage you to take a moment to write your own list of what you need to Get Behind You.
On a piece of paper write: “What I Need To Get Behind Me.”
